What ⁣is‍ Blockchain and Why Is It⁤ Disrupting​ Education?

At it’s core, blockchain is a decentralized, immutable ledger that records transactions across a distributed network. Its inherent transparency, security, and tamper-resistance make it ideal for managing sensitive and valuable details,⁤ such as educational records and⁣ credentials.

Key Features of Blockchain for ⁤Education:

  • Decentralization and transparency for academic data
  • Immutable storage and easy verification of credentials
  • Automated processes through smart contracts
  • Enhanced data security and privacy

Real-World‍ Case‍ Studies: Blockchain in⁢ Action

Many forward-thinking educational institutions are already integrating blockchain to improve ⁢transparency⁣ and efficiency.

Institution Blockchain Use Case Key Outcomes
MIT Issuing digital diplomas on blockchain Reduced verification time, eliminated ​diploma fraud
Malta’s Ministry for Education Blockchain-based student certificates Efficient cross-institutional recognition, data privacy
Open University (UK) Blockchain for micro-credentials personalized learning and career pathways

Step-by-Step: How to Implement Blockchain⁢ in​ Educational Institutions

Ready to embark ⁤on the blockchain journey? Here’s a ⁢practical roadmap for integrating blockchain technology into your educational institution:

  1. Identify Your needs and Objectives

    • Is⁤ your ‍focus on credential ⁤verification, administrative automation, or something else?
    • Assess your current digital infrastructure and resources.

  2. Choose the Right Blockchain ‌Platform

    • Evaluate platforms like Ethereum,‌ Hyperledger,‍ or​ Corda.
    • Consider scalability,security,and ‍ease of integration.

  3. Build Stakeholder Consensus

    • Engage faculty, students, IT teams, and administration for feedback and buy-in.
    • Address concerns about data privacy and ​change management.

  4. Develop a Pilot Project

    • Start small—perhaps with blockchain-based diploma issuance or credential validation.
    • Measure results and gather ‌user feedback.

  5. Integrate with Existing systems

    • Ensure seamless data transfer between current databases⁤ and the blockchain.
    • Plan for technical support​ and user training.

  6. Scale and Optimize

    • Analyze pilot outcomes to refine your approach.
    • Gradually expand the blockchain solution ​across departments ⁢or⁣ campuses.

Challenges to Consider When Implementing Blockchain‌ in Education

While the opportunities are enticing, blockchain adoption in education‌ is‍ not ‍without‍ hurdles.

  • Technical Complexity: Implementing and maintaining blockchain infrastructure requires specialized skills.
  • Initial Investment: Upfront costs can be meaningful, though long-term savings are ⁣likely.
  • Change Management: Resistance from staff and stakeholders may slow adoption.
  • Regulatory Uncertainty: Ongoing changes in data privacy and ​digital ⁤credential laws⁣ can affect deployment.
  • Scalability Issues: Some public blockchains may struggle with large-scale implementations.

Awareness of these⁣ challenges—and a willingness to adapt—will set your educational‍ institution​ on the path to successful ⁢integration.
